How much does it cost to rent a home in Deal?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Deal 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$5,120 | $1,700 | $10,000+ |
| Deal 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$8,885 | $1,800 | $10,000+ |
| Deal 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$10,824 | $1,800 | $10,000+ |
| Deal 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$18,359 | $2,000 | $10,000+ |
| Deal 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$10,957 | $2,500 | $10,000+ |
| Deal 7 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$23,714 | $3,700 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Deal
What type of rentals are currently available in Deal?
There are currently 415 Apartments for Rent in Deal, NJ with pricing that ranges from $821 to $15,500. There are also 343 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Deal ranging from $1,600 to $95,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Deal?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Deal ranges from $1,600 to $95,000 with an average monthly rent of $16,824.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Deal?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Deal range from $3,000 to $5,850,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,800 to $59,000.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,800 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$8,890.
